Output 660ec8bc377c045fb1f745eec1bafb2199a155d998428360c5b6e56cfa119d07:0

value
3108135984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26c3781b5fec17292fbb1e029b68b3a70457b2e4 OP_EQUAL
address
35DymGZmzWbxsCpSqx4nRJDhNTsWFgKQtE
transaction
660ec8bc377c045fb1f745eec1bafb2199a155d998428360c5b6e56cfa119d07
spent
true